What is the largest number among the following?
- (a) (1/2)^-6
- (b) (1/4)^-3
- (c) (1/3)^-4 ✓ UPSC's answer
- (d) (1/6)^-2
Why the answer is (c)
• To compare the numbers, convert each expression with a negative exponent into a positive power by inverting the base fraction.
• Option (a) (1/2)^-6 becomes 2^6, which equals 64.
• Option (b) (1/4)^-3 becomes 4^3, which equals 64.
• Option (c) (1/3)^-4 becomes 3^4, which equals 81.
• Option (d) (1/6)^-2 becomes 6^2, which equals 36.
• Comparing the calculated values (64, 64, 81, and 36), 81 is the largest number, so option (c) is the correct answer.
